#8f5354 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8f5354 is composed of 56.1% red, 32.5%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42% magenta, 41.3%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 359 degrees, a saturation of 26.5% and a lightness of 44.3%. #8f5354 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a6a8 with #1f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#8f5354
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060404 is the darkest color, while #fcf9f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#8f5354
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#756d6d is the less saturated color, while #dd0508 is the most saturated one.
